Event Details
The Event Details entity specifies an event to be used the Reminder type Creative, this entity is immutable once created, none of the attributes can be edited.
The event start time is in UTC timing by default, you will need to add or subtract hours to fit timings in other time zones, also taking daylight savings into account.
Event Details Attributes
| Attribute | Description | Required | Possible Values |
|---|---|---|---|
| event_name | R | Max length 300 characters | |
| event_time_zone | The event_time_zone is an optional parameter which is only used for display purposes by Snap Ads Manager, if this attribute is left out it will default to the time zone of the Ad Account | O | Africa/Cairo, Africa/Johannesburg, America/Anchorage, America/Cancun, America/Chicago, America/Dawson, America/Dawson_Creek, America/Denver, America/Edmonton, America/Halifax, America/Hermosillo, America/Los_Angeles, America/Mazatlan, America/Mexico_City, America/Montevideo, America/New_York, America/Phoenix, America/Rainy_River, America/Regina, America/Tijuana, America/Toronto, America/Vancouver, Asia/Amman, Asia/Beirut, Asia/Dubai, Asia/Hong_Kong, Asia/Irkutsk, Asia/Jerusalem, Asia/Kamchatka, Asia/Krasnoyarsk, Asia/Magadan, Asia/Nicosia, Asia/Omsk, Asia/Qatar, Asia/Riyadh, Asia/Shanghai, Asia/Singapore, Asia/Vladivostok, Asia/Yakutsk, Asia/Yekaterinburg, Atlantic/Canary, Australia/Perth, Australia/Sydney, Europe/Amsterdam, Europe/Berlin, Europe/Brussels, Europe/Dublin, Europe/Helsinki, Europe/Istanbul, Europe/Kaliningrad, Europe/London, Europe/Luxembourg, Europe/Madrid, Europe/Malta, Europe/Moscow, Europe/Oslo, Europe/Paris, Europe/Rome, Europe/Samara, Europe/Stockholm, Europe/Vienna, Europe/Vilnius, Europe/Warsaw, Europe/Zurich, Pacific/Auckland, Pacific/Honolulu, UTC |
| event_start_time | Start date in ISO code format, year, month, day, hour (optional), minutes(optional), seconds(optional). The date is in UTC you will need to offset the date to match the region the event is located in, the delimiter between day and hour in the date needs to be a T character. | R | Example; 2025-11-16T09:00:00 - Event starts at 16 November 4am Eastern time |
| ad_account_id | The Ad Account where the event details lives | R |
Create an Event Details entity
This endpoint will create an Event Details entity within a specified ad account.
HTTP Request
POST https://adsapi.snapchat.com/v1/adaccounts/{ad_account_id}/event_details
Parameters
| Parameter | Default | Description |
|---|---|---|
| ad_account_id | Ad Account ID |
curl -X POST \
-H "Authorization: Bearer meowmeowmeow" \
-H "Content-Type: application/json" \
-d '{"event_details":[{"event_name": "Poodle Show Launch","event_time_zone": "America/New_York","event_start_time": "2025-11-16T00:00:00-04:00:00,"ad_account_id": "82225ba6-7559-4000-9663-bace8adff5f8"}]}' \
"https://adsapi.snapchat.com/v1/adaccounts/82225ba6-7559-4000-9663-bace8adff5f8/event_details"
The above command returns JSON structured like this:
{
"request_status": "SUCCESS",
"request_id": "082bcf55-c594-4de8-a944-aee8e2986cff",
"event_details": [
{
"sub_request_status": "SUCCESS",
"event_detail": {
"id": "b762edbd-7f9b-44ea-8dd0-f9f3e6405aec",
"updated_at": "2025-03-18T11:38:04.359Z",
"created_at": "2025-03-18T11:38:04.359Z",
"event_name": "Poodle Show Launch",
"event_start_time": "2025-11-16T04:00:00.000Z",
"event_time_zone": "America/New_York",
"ad_account_id": "82225ba6-7559-4000-9663-bace8adff5f8"
}
}
]
}
Get an Event Details entity
This endpoint retrieves a specific Event Details entity.
HTTP Request
GET https://adsapi.snapchat.com/v1/event_details/{event_details_id}
URL Parameters
| Parameter | Default | Description |
|---|---|---|
| event_details_id | Event Details ID |
curl "https://asapi.snapchat.com/v1/event_details/5ec9b3d8-8ad7-4375-a835-16f21742823e" \
-H "Authorization: Bearer meowmeowmeow"
The above command returns JSON structured like this:
{
"request_status": "SUCCESS",
"request_id": "7ce99e05-cd84-43f1-a138-11cb6200465f",
"event_details": [
{
"sub_request_status": "SUCCESS",
"event_detail": {
"id": "5ec9b3d8-8ad7-4375-a835-16f21742823e",
"updated_at": "2025-02-24T16:12:55.747Z",
"created_at": "2025-02-24T16:12:55.747Z",
"event_name": "Squirrels Motion Picture launch",
"event_start_time": "2025-12-10T10:00:00.000Z",
"event_time_zone": "America/New_York",
"ad_account_id": "82225ba6-7559-4000-9663-bace8adff5f8"
}
}
]
}
Get all Event Details entities under an Ad Account
This endpoint retrieves all Event Details entities under an Ad Account.
HTTP Request
GET https://adsapi.snapchat.com/v1/adaccounts/{ad_account_id}/event_details
URL Parameters
| Parameter | Default | Description |
|---|---|---|
| ad_account_id | Ad Account ID |
curl "https://adsapi.snapchat.com/v1/adaccounts/82225ba6-7559-4000-9663-bace8adff5f8/event_details" \
-H "Authorization: Bearer meowmeowmeow"
The above command returns JSON structured like this:
"request_status": "SUCCESS",
"request_id": "43499453-db00-4574-aef4-60dc39f0f6bb",
"paging": {},
"event_details": [
{
"sub_request_status": "SUCCESS",
"event_detail": {
"id": "5ec9b3d8-8ad7-4375-a835-16f21742823e",
"updated_at": "2025-02-24T16:12:55.747Z",
"created_at": "2025-02-24T16:12:55.747Z",
"event_name": "Squirrels Motion Picture launch",
"event_start_time": "2025-12-10T10:00:00.000Z",
"event_time_zone": "America/New_York",
"ad_account_id": "82225ba6-7559-4000-9663-bace8adff5f8"
}
},
{
"sub_request_status": "SUCCESS",
"event_detail": {
"id": "b762edbd-7f9b-44ea-8dd0-f9f3e6405aec",
"updated_at": "2025-03-18T11:38:04.359Z",
"created_at": "2025-03-18T11:38:04.359Z",
"event_name": "Poodle Show Launch",
"event_start_time": "2025-11-16T04:00:00.000Z",
"event_time_zone": "America/New_York",
"ad_account_id": "82225ba6-7559-4000-9663-bace8adff5f8"
}
}
]
}
Delete an Event Details entity
This endpoint deletes a specific Event Details entity, we recommend that you use this endpoint with caution as there is no way to reinstate a deleted entity. Before you delete an Event Details entity you should always make sure it's not being used by an active Reminder Creative.
HTTP Request
DELETE https://adsapi.snapchat.com/v1/event_details/{event_details_id}
URL Parameters
| Parameter | Description |
|---|---|
| event_details_id | The ID of the Event Details entity to be deleted |
curl -X DELETE "https://adsapi.snapchat.com/v1/event_details/7ded6d53-0805-4ff8-b984-54a7eb5c8918" \
-H "Authorization: Bearer meowmeowmeow"
The above command returns JSON structured like this:
{
"request_status": "success",
"request_id": "57b01b6200ff05d100ff30ca9b1d0001737e616473617069736300016275696c642d35396264653638322d312d31312d3700010101",
"ads": []
}